Serum Follistatin (FST)

Autocrine and circulating glycoprotein that binds with high affinity to myostatin (GDF-8) and activin A, neutralizing their inhibitory actions.

Molecular Mechanism & Clinical Purpose

Prevents myostatin from binding ActRIIB receptors, unleashing satellite cell proliferation and skeletal muscle hypertrophy.

Differential Diagnosis

Elevated Levels (FST High)

  • •Physiological response to resistance exercise
  • •Follistatin gene therapy / supplementation models

Low Levels (FST Low)

  • •Severe sarcopenia and frailty
  • •Unchecked myostatin-mediated muscle wasting
  • •Cachexia
